CITI'S TAKE

KEY reported 2Q26 EBITDA of C$309mm (ex transaction costs), above

Citi estimate of C$291mm. Elevated margins across all segments

appeared to drive the beat. Notably, G&P margins benefitted from

increased producer activity in the rich, higher margin Northern G&P region.

KEY's frac throughput commentary indicates all Alberta fractionation

capacity is running at or near capacity during the quarter. Outside of

results, KEY's growth outlook and '26 Marketing guidance were reiterated

- unsurprising given the recent guidance refresh in June. Notably, the '26

Marketing guidance implies a ~$127mm ramp in quarterly EBITDA in 2H26

is required to hit the midpoint which likely reflects tailwinds from AEF

inventory sales and Plains asset contribution. Near-term Plains synergy

capture also remains on-track with a commercial synergy update likely

coming later in the year.

Implications — We expect a neutral reaction to the print; both long-term fee-based

guidance and '26 marketing guidance were reiterated. The earnings beat is positive

and largely margin related. The reaction may come down to call commentary with

respect to the durability of the margin beat and volume outlook for the remainder of

the year, especially with some maintenance events in 3Q impacting Empress. On the

back of two major transactions in 2Q, the results appear a little noisy and may be

hard to compare. We see upside to the Marketing guidance on the back of

anticipated inventory sales into a constructive iso-octane environment, but that

update might be a 3Q26 event. Any management commentary on the ongoing

Competition Tribunal process could be a larger driver of the reaction, though we

expect limited commentary here given the ongoing process.
